According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 601 reports of Chest pain have been filed in association with TIOTROPIUM (Tiotropium Bromide). This represents 1.3% of all adverse event reports for TIOTROPIUM.

How Dangerous Is Chest pain From TIOTROPIUM?
Of the 601 reports, 10 (1.7%) resulted in death, 239 (39.8%) required hospitalization, and 26 (4.3%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Chest pain Listed in the Official Label?
Yes, Chest pain is listed as a known adverse reaction in the official FDA drug label for TIOTROPIUM.
